QR codes for hospitals
Hospital QR codes work at institutional scale only with a register: every code's URL, location, owner and review date recorded, one template, one domain. The highest-value chain runs from the car park to the ward — wayfinding codes at each decision point, never carrying patient data.
Run codes like estates runs signs
The clinical rules — no patient data in payloads, printed alternatives always, wristband constraints — are on the healthcare page. What a hospital adds is scale: hundreds of codes across dozens of departments, printed by different teams over years. Without governance, that decays into dead links on permanent signage.
The fix is a code register, exactly like an estates asset list: for every code, its URL, physical location, owning department, print date and next review date. Add every new code at print time; walk the register annually with a phone. A hospital that cannot say how many QR codes it has displayed has some pointing at retired pages — link rot on a laminated sign outlives the intranet page it pointed to.
One template, one official domain, and bulk generation from the register keeps the estate consistent.
The parking-to-ward problem
The hardest journey in the building starts in the car park: anxious visitor, unfamiliar site, appointment letter naming a ward. Chain the codes along the actual decision points:
| Point | Code links to |
|---|---|
| Appointment letter | Directions page for that clinic, plus a geo pin for the right car park |
| Car-park exit | Site map with walking routes |
| Main entrance and each junction | Step-free route to each department |
| Lift lobbies | Floor directory |
Corridor sizing and mounting heights follow the healthcare signage numbers; pair every code with printed directions, since many visitors will not scan.
Visitor information
Ward-specific visiting hours, what to bring, infection-control rules — printed on the ward door with a code to the live version. The printed sheet answers today's visitor; the code stays correct when policy changes tomorrow.
Discharge and the token pattern
Discharge codes may link generic aftercare pages freely. Anything patient-specific must use an opaque token resolved by an authenticated portal — the token-not-record pattern — so a photographed letter leaks nothing. Never encode the record; encode a pointer only the system can resolve.
FAQ
How should a hospital manage hundreds of QR codes?
With a register: URL, location, owner, print date and review date for every code, managed like any estates asset list. Review annually with a phone in hand. Unregistered codes on permanent signage are how hospitals end up with laminated dead links.
What should hospital wayfinding QR codes link to?
The step-free route to a specific destination from the code's own location — not a generic site map. The appointment letter's code should carry the clinic's directions page and the correct car park, since the journey starts before the building.
Can discharge instructions go behind a QR code?
Generic aftercare pages, yes. Patient-specific instructions need an opaque token that an authenticated portal resolves, so the code on a photographable letter identifies nothing. A printed copy must always accompany the code.
